Gene
Length: 2369  
Chromosome Location: Chr2: 14224268-14226636
Organism . Short Name: A. thaliana
TAIR Computational Description: NAD(P)-binding Rossmann-fold superfamily protein;(source:Araport11)
TAIR Curator Summary: Encodes a protein with homology to members of the dihydroflavonol-4-reductase (DFR) superfamily. The expression pattern of AtCRL1 indicates that CRL1 has a role in embryogenesis and seed germination. AtCRL1 is induced by ABA, drought and heat, and is highly expressed in seeds. The mRNA is cell-to-cell mobile.
TAIR Short Description: NAD(P)-binding Rossmann-fold superfamily protein
TAIR Aliases: AtCRL1, CRL1
